a study of uremic toxicology

middle molecule (mm) fractions (7a, b, c) obtained by chromatography were each separated in at least two fractions with different mobility and uv-absorption. preparative isotachophoresis proves to be a suitable method for isolation of pure mm compounds. the automatic mm analyzer, which combines gel filtration and ion exchange gradient elution chromatography was used for analysis of mm. the results together with various clinical and biochemical data are stored and processed by a pdp 8 computer. non-dialyzed and dialyzed patients are now followed on a prospective basis and correlations are sought to residual renal function, efficiency of dialysis, biochemical variables and clinical symtoms. the results are not fully evaluated yet. hemoperfusion through active carbon removed mm from uremic blood in vivo, but was not more effective than hemodialysis. mm exerted toxic effects in vitro on erythropoiesis, granulocyte stem-cell proliferation, platelet aggregation and on the enzyme gamma-laevuliniv acid hydrase, but no on single nerve fibers
